Transaction d0b6666843dd33f597dc97323591c69d18445e29cc2b43e67cefd5495ad1e5a5

1 Input
2 Outputs
  • d0b6666843dd33f597dc97323591c69d18445e29cc2b43e67cefd5495ad1e5a5:0
  • value  4684500
    address  34pJVzstNJh3bykYfkEiuKU7etdmih4Gas
  • d0b6666843dd33f597dc97323591c69d18445e29cc2b43e67cefd5495ad1e5a5:1
  • value  25157314
    address  3EDLSN2P4YGzg8BvgVheoKFjSqGL9kqNa4